Câu hỏi tự luận mức độ nhận biết Tin học ứng dụng 12 ctst bài F5: Tạo biểu mẫu trong trang web

1. NHẬN BIẾT (5 CÂU)

Câu 1: Biểu mẫu trong trang web là gì? Nêu chức năng của biểu mẫu?

Câu 2: Liệt kê các thành phần cơ bản của một biểu mẫu HTML?

Câu 3: Nêu định nghĩa về thẻ <form> trong HTML?

Câu 4: Mô tả cách thức mà trình duyệt xử lý dữ liệu từ một biểu mẫu khi người dùng nhấn nút gửi?

Câu 5: Giải thích vai trò của thuộc tính required trong các trường nhập liệu của biểu mẫu?


 Câu 1: 

- Biểu mẫu (form) trong trang web là một phần tử HTML cho phép người dùng nhập và gửi dữ liệu đến máy chủ.

- Chức năng của biểu mẫu:

+ Nhập liệu: Cho phép người dùng nhập thông tin như tên, địa chỉ, email, v.v.

+ Gửi dữ liệu: Gửi thông tin đến máy chủ để xử lý, ví dụ như đăng ký tài khoản, gửi phản hồi, hoặc thực hiện thanh toán.

+ Tương tác: Tạo ra sự tương tác giữa người dùng và trang web, như tìm kiếm thông tin, đăng nhập, hoặc gửi phản hồi.

Câu 2: 

Các thành phần cơ bản của một biểu mẫu HTML bao gồm:

+ Thẻ <form>: Định nghĩa biểu mẫu.

+ Trường nhập liệu: Bao gồm các thẻ như <input>, <textarea>, và <select>.

+ Nút gửi: Thẻ <button> hoặc <input type="submit"> để gửi dữ liệu.

+ Nhãn: Thẻ <label> để mô tả trường nhập liệu.

Câu 3:

- Thẻ <form> trong HTML được sử dụng để tạo ra một biểu mẫu cho phép người dùng nhập dữ liệu. Nó bao gồm các thuộc tính như action (địa chỉ gửi dữ liệu), method (phương thức gửi dữ liệu, ví dụ: GET hoặc POST), và enctype (kiểu mã hóa dữ liệu).

Câu 4: 

Khi người dùng nhấn nút gửi trong biểu mẫu:

+ Xác thực dữ liệu: Trình duyệt kiểm tra các trường nhập liệu theo các quy tắc xác thực (như thuộc tính required).

+ Thu thập dữ liệu: Trình duyệt thu thập dữ liệu từ tất cả các trường nhập liệu trong biểu mẫu.

+ Gửi dữ liệu: Dữ liệu được gửi đến địa chỉ đã chỉ định trong thuộc tính action của thẻ <form> bằng phương thức đã chỉ định (GET hoặc POST).

+ Xử lý dữ liệu: Máy chủ nhận dữ liệu và thực hiện các thao tác cần thiết (như lưu trữ, xử lý, phản hồi).

Câu 5: 

- Xác thực bắt buộc: Đánh dấu trường nhập liệu là bắt buộc, nghĩa là người dùng phải nhập dữ liệu vào trường đó trước khi gửi biểu mẫu.

- Cải thiện trải nghiệm người dùng: Giúp người dùng nhận biết nhanh chóng các trường cần thiết, từ đó giảm thiểu lỗi và tăng tính chính xác của dữ liệu.

- Ngăn gửi biểu mẫu: Nếu trường nhập liệu có thuộc tính required mà không có dữ liệu, trình duyệt sẽ không cho phép gửi biểu mẫu và hiển thị thông báo lỗi.


Bình luận

Giải bài tập những môn khác